質問編集履歴

2

投稿の時に誤ったコードを記載してしまいました。修正しました。

2019/04/27 12:18

投稿

hakase
hakase

スコア107

test CHANGED
File without changes
test CHANGED
@@ -52,7 +52,7 @@
52
52
 
53
53
 
54
54
 
55
- String data=req.getParameter("data");
55
+ String[] data=req.getParameterValues("data");
56
56
 
57
57
  res.setContentType("text/plain; charset=utf-8");
58
58
 

1

追記依頼に対して編集しました。

2019/04/27 12:18

投稿

hakase
hakase

スコア107

test CHANGED
File without changes
test CHANGED
@@ -9,6 +9,28 @@
9
9
  困っています。アドバイスよろしくお願いします。
10
10
 
11
11
 
12
+
13
+ http://localhost/post.phpをたたきます。
14
+
15
+ 中で、http://localhost:8080/app/testにHTTP-POSTしています。
16
+
17
+ しかしnullになって、"data is empty"が表示されます。
18
+
19
+ post.phpのurlをpostcheck.phpにすると、'a'が表示されます。
20
+
21
+
22
+
23
+ http://localhost/form.htmlをたたいた場合にはservletは
24
+
25
+ 正しく、'data is a'を返します。
26
+
27
+
28
+
29
+ よろしくお願いします。
30
+
31
+
32
+
33
+ http://localhost:8080/app/test
12
34
 
13
35
  ```Java
14
36
 
@@ -52,6 +74,8 @@
52
74
 
53
75
  ```
54
76
 
77
+ http://localhost/post.php
78
+
55
79
  ```PHP
56
80
 
57
81
  $data=array('data'=>array('a','b'));
@@ -80,6 +104,8 @@
80
104
 
81
105
  ```
82
106
 
107
+ $url='http://localhost/postcheck.php';
108
+
83
109
  ```PHP
84
110
 
85
111
  <?php
@@ -89,6 +115,8 @@
89
115
  ?>
90
116
 
91
117
  ```
118
+
119
+ http://localhost/form.html
92
120
 
93
121
  ```HTML
94
122